Health Minister confirms wait between AstraZeneca doses to be reduced from twelve weeks to eight

Health Minister confirms wait between AstraZeneca doses to be reduced from twelve weeks to eight It’s hoped that the change will allow more people to be vaccinated sooner, but the exact timing depends on supply of the vaccine. By Lauren Boland Friday 4 Jun 2021, 4:40 PM 1 hour ago 8,223 Views 12 Comments Image: Shutterstock Image: Shutterstock THE WAIT BETWEEN receiving each dose of the AstraZeneca vaccine is to be reduced from 12 weeks to eight, the Minister for Health has confirmed. Health Minister Stephen Donnelly has confirmed that the interval between the two doses will be reduced by a third following advice from the National Immunisation Advisory Committee (NIAC).
